Pembroke Textile Mill New England Series - 8" x 5 1/2" x 7 3/4" - coordinates with DT80724-6 The Latest Pembroke Fabrics - Textiles were a primary industry in The New England region during the 19th century, many mills were built along rivers to take advantage of the hydro power. Wool was brought to the mill from farms nearby, where it was spun into yarn and woven into fine fabrics. The name, Pembroke, is taken from an area along the Merrimack River, near Concord, New Hampshire, where the textile industry was prevalent. The waterwheel turns, adapter cord and 12V bulb included
